深入解析VPN原理,如何实现安全远程访问与隐私保护?

hk258369 2026-01-16 翻墙VPN 2 0

在当今高度互联的数字世界中,虚拟私人网络(Virtual Private Network,简称VPN)已成为企业和个人用户保障网络安全、隐私保护和跨地域访问的重要工具,作为一名网络工程师,我将从技术角度深入剖析VPN的基本原理,帮助你理解它如何在不安全的公共网络(如互联网)上建立加密隧道,实现安全通信。

我们需要明确一个核心概念:什么是“虚拟私有网络”?它是通过公网搭建的一条逻辑上的专用通道,使用户仿佛置身于一个私有的局域网中,这一过程依赖于多种关键技术,包括隧道协议、加密算法和身份认证机制。

VPN的核心原理是“隧道技术”,当客户端(如一台电脑或移动设备)连接到远程服务器时,它会创建一个加密的“隧道”,数据包在这个隧道中传输,不会暴露给外界,常用的隧道协议包括PPTP(点对点隧道协议)、L2TP/IPsec(第二层隧道协议/互联网安全协议)、OpenVPN以及最近广受欢迎的WireGuard,这些协议决定了数据封装方式、加密强度和性能表现。

以IPsec为例,它是一种广泛使用的安全协议套件,常用于站点到站点(Site-to-Site)或远程访问(Remote Access)型VPN,IPsec工作在OSI模型的网络层(第三层),可以加密整个IP数据包,确保端到端的安全性,它分为两个主要组件:AH(认证头)提供完整性验证,ESP(封装安全载荷)则同时提供加密和认证功能,当数据从本地主机发出时,IPsec会在其外层添加一个新IP头部,并使用密钥进行加密,从而形成一个不可读的数据包,只有拥有解密密钥的对端才能还原原始内容。

另一个关键环节是身份认证,为了防止未授权访问,大多数现代VPN系统采用强认证机制,例如用户名/密码、数字证书(X.509)、双因素认证(2FA)甚至硬件令牌,在企业环境中,员工可能需要输入公司账户密码,再通过手机APP生成一次性验证码,双重验证后才能接入内部资源。

DNS泄漏防护、NAT穿越(NAT Traversal)等也是VPN设计中必须考虑的问题,如果DNS查询未经加密,即使流量本身被保护,也可能泄露用户的浏览行为,高级VPN服务通常会强制所有DNS请求通过加密隧道转发,防止信息泄露。

最后值得一提的是,尽管VPN提供了强大的安全保障,但它的安全性也取决于配置是否得当,若使用弱加密算法(如RC4)、未启用证书验证、或服务器存在漏洞,仍可能导致数据泄露,作为网络工程师,我们在部署VPN时必须遵循最小权限原则、定期更新固件、并实施日志审计与入侵检测机制。

理解VPN的工作原理不仅有助于我们更安全地使用互联网,也能让我们在面对日益复杂的网络威胁时做出明智的技术选择,无论是远程办公、跨国协作还是个人隐私保护,VPN都扮演着不可或缺的角色——而掌握其底层逻辑,则是我们构建可信网络环境的第一步。

深入解析VPN原理,如何实现安全远程访问与隐私保护?